Ako analyzujem adresu URL na názov hostiteľa a cestu v JavaScripte?

Ako Analyzujem Adresu Url Na Nazov Hostitela A Cestu V Javascripte



V JavaScripte sa analýza využíva na konverziu veľkého množstva neštruktúrovaných údajov do čitateľného a jednoduchšieho formátu. Údaje môžete analyzovať vo forme reťazcov, objektov a adries URL konkrétnej webovej lokality. Ak chcete analyzovať konkrétnu adresu URL v jazyku JavaScript, použite „ URL() “konštruktér. Vytvorí nový objekt URL s hostiteľom, názvom cesty, vyhľadávacím hashom a vlastnosťami hash.

Tento príspevok ilustruje metódu analýzy adresy URL na názov hostiteľa a cestu v jazyku JavaScript.







Analýza adresy URL (webovej adresy) na názov hostiteľa a cestu v jazyku JavaScript

Ak chcete analyzovať adresu URL na názov hostiteľa a cestu v jazyku JavaScript, použite adresu URL aktuálnej stránky pomocou „ window.location.href ' nehnuteľnosť. Okrem toho možno konkrétnu adresu URL analyzovať aj pomocou „ URL() “.



Pre praktické dôsledky si pozrite uvedené príklady:



Príklad 1: Analyzujte adresu URL aktuálnej stránky na názov hostiteľa a cestu

Adresu URL aktuálnej stránky môžete analyzovať na názov hostiteľa a cestu v jazyku JavaScript. Na tento účel použite nasledujúci kód v časti HTML:





  • Pridaj '

    ” a priraďte id pomocou “ id “.

  • Vytvorte tlačidlo pomocou „ a vyvolajte prvok po kliknutí ” udalosť na vykonanie konkrétnej udalosti, keď používateľ klikne na tlačidlo. Ďalej vyvolajte funkciu ako hodnotu tejto udalosti:
< p id = 'id' > p >
< tlačidlo onclick = 'func()' > Analyzovať na URL tlačidlo >
< p id = 'id2' > p >
< p id = 'id3' > p >

V časti JavaScript získajte prvé ID pomocou „ getElementById() “ metóda a nastavte “ window.location.href ” na analýzu adresy URL aktuálnej stránky:

dokument. getElementById ( 'id1' ) . innerHTML = okno. umiestnenie . href ;

Funkcia je definovaná ako „ func() “, ktorý pristupuje k druhému prvku pomocou „ id2 “. Aplikujte in-line styling pomocou „

” HTML tag a nastavte farbu. Potom použite „ window.location.hostname ” vlastnosť, ktorá vráti adresu URL aktuálnej stránky:



funkciu func ( ) {
dokument. getElementById ( 'id2' ) . innerHTML = ` < štýl h2 = 'farba:modra;' > Meno hosťa : h2 > ` + okno. umiestnenie . meno hosťa ;
dokument. getElementById ( 'id3' ) . innerHTML = ` < štýl h2 = 'farba:modra;' > Cesta : h2 > ` + okno. umiestnenie . názov cesty ;
}

Výkon

Je možné pozorovať, že názov hostiteľa a cesta aktuálnej stránky sa zobrazia na obrazovke po kliknutí na tlačidlo:

Príklad 2: Analyzujte adresu URL na názov hostiteľa a cestu pomocou metódy URL().

Môžete tiež analyzovať adresu URL na názov hostiteľa a cestu pomocou „ URL() “. Ak to chcete urobiť, použite vyššie uvedený kód HTML a potom pridajte kód JavaScript uvedený nižšie. Na tento účel inicializujte objekt a použite „ URL() ” a odošlite URL konkrétnej stránky ako argument metóde:

bol moja_url = Nový URL ( 'https://linuxhint.com/' ) ;

Získajte prístup k prvku HTML pomocou jeho ID pomocou „ getElementById() “ metóda:

dokument. getElementById ( 'id1' ) . innerHTML = moja_url ;

Vytvorte funkciu s názvom a získajte prístup k ďalším prvkom HTML:

funkciu func ( ) {
dokument. getElementById ( 'id2' ) . innerHTML = ` < štýl h2 = 'farba:modra;' > Meno hosťa : h2 > ` + moja_url. meno hosťa ;
dokument. getElementById ( 'id3' ) . innerHTML = ` < štýl h2 = 'farba:modra;' > Cesta : h2 > ` + moja_url. názov cesty ;
}

Výkon

To je všetko o analýze adresy URL / webovej adresy na názov hostiteľa a cestu v jazyku JavaScript.

Záver

V jazyku JavaScript „ window.location.href ” možno použiť na analýzu adresy URL aktuálnej stránky. Okrem toho možno konkrétnu adresu URL analyzovať aj pomocou „ URL() “. Tento tutoriál vysvetlil podrobný postup analýzy adresy URL (webovej adresy) na názov hostiteľa a cestu rôznymi spôsobmi.